Live Class 24 Sports and Social Justice – Andrea Andrews

During this lesson, students will explore Black athletes that have made positive social change against racial prejudice in the United States. We will also read Teammates by Peter Golenbock, a book that tells the story of Jackie Robinson, the first Black man to play Major League baseball.
